Transaction 348ee216e5c7785039cb75057ffcd970f5936c032e4db7d02cb528421b7c5efe

block
651530ffa6eed7bc499ff02ecdccb2fab30b32429de09839d5742364e609cb7b

18 Inputs

2 Outputs